Kristiyan Velkov, a Docker Captain and front‑end tech lead with more than ten years of web‑development experience, has made Docker a core part of his daily workflow. He builds React, Next.js, Angular, and Vue.js applications, focusing on production‑ready Dockerfiles, multi‑stage builds, and reliable CI/CD pipelines that work consistently across environments. Velkov has authored four technical books, including Docker for Front‑end Developers, and contributes to official Docker guides for major front‑end frameworks. His goal as a Docker Captain is to bridge the gap between front‑end developers and DevOps teams, sharing practical solutions that reduce friction and improve collaboration.
